What's the hype about raw foods?

Some raw foodies, go so far as not consuming anything that has been stirred or blended in fear of this process heating the foods, so what’s all the hype about? Why would anyone want to eat this way?

It’s said that when we cook or heat a food, we are destroying the nutrients, vitamins and minerals present, and disabling the naturally occurring enzymes present that help us digest the food.

 

How cooking transforms the properties of food?

Heating food has the additional downside of transforming into acidic toxins, which can be very damaging to our health.
